General manager Mickey Loomis realistic as Saints seek to plug holes with limited resources
 
1 Attachment(s)
Saints general manager Mickey Loomis is a realist.

He knows the Saints entered free agency with limited cap space and were going to be limited in the things they were going to be able to accomplish. He had his lists of “musts, needs and wants” and made calls on a handful of players, but some of those things simply didn’t work out.

“Man, it feels like every year it’s higher than you expect,” he said Monday at LSU’s Pro Day.

So during the first wave of free agency, New Orleans focused on retaining the players it felt it could not afford to lose and was able to strike a deal with tight end Coby Fleener after losing Ben Watson to the Baltimore Ravens.

Loomis is aware that many fans wanted the team to focus on defense, and he sees the logic behind that thinking, but the team had to make the moves it was able to make.

“We have limitations in resources,” Loomis said. “You have to fill the right hole with the right value. It may end up being an offensive player when you’re looking to help your defense, or when you have a good defense — there’s nothing wrong with getting a good value and a good player.

“It doesn’t always fall like you would hope in a perfect world, and you have to adjust to that.”
